The space between two double-glazed panes holds air and forms an insulation layer. This can reduce your energy bills by stopping cold air from entering and warm air from exiting. Additionally, the extra glass and insulation can reduce the frequency of sound waves, which is an enormous benefit for homeowners who reside near busy freeways or airports.

Double glazing can also reduce condensation on windows. Our air contains moisture in the form of tiny molecular droplets of water, which are inaccessible to the naked eye. These droplets of water are separated however, when they come into contact with a cooler surface such as a windowpane, they clump together and create visible drops of condensation. This condensation can cause mould and mildew and even cause the frame of your window to rot.

Double-glazed windows can reduce condensation because they use an inner glass which is warmer than the outer glass. This will save you money on cleaning costs and safeguard your furniture from damage caused by humidity and mold.

Double glazed windows can't be fixed if the seals fail. If the seals aren't air tight there will be condensation between the two panes and you won't be able remove them to fix the issue.
